i lift weights occasionally, do calisthenics, and walk a lot (especially in the summer). most of my exercise is fasted. i don’t really think of it as “working out,” but i practice heated vinyasa yoga about 5–7x a week, which ended up being the most consistent thing for me.

yoga asana has honestly been extremely nourishing for my body. it helped a lot with circulation/lymphatic flow, and it was also around the time i started getting my cholesterol under control.

diet-wise i switched to high carb, moderate protein, and low fat because of the cholesterol. i cut out dairy completely (i used to eat a pint of ice cream almost every day… dark times lol). cutting out red meat also made a big difference for me. my body seems to respond really well to that way of eating so i’ve stuck with it.
